What Are Millets?

Millets are a group of small-seeded, nutrient-rich grains cultivated for thousands of years. Naturally gluten-free, they are an excellent alternative for people with celiac disease or gluten sensitivity. Popular types of millets include:

  • Sorghum (Jowar)

  • Pearl millet (Bajra)

  • Finger millet (Ragi)

  • Foxtail millet (Kangni)

These versatile grains can be used in breakfasts, snacks, main meals, and baked goods, making them a superfood for everyday nutrition.


Health Benefits of Millets

Millets are packed with fiber, protein, vitamins, and minerals, making them a nutritious addition to any diet. Key health benefits include:

  • Supporting heart health

  • Managing blood sugar levels (low glycemic index)

  • Aiding weight management and obesity prevention

  • Boosting digestive health

Incorporating millets into your diet can help improve overall wellness and provide sustained energy throughout the day.

How to Cook with Millets

Millets are easy to cook and can replace rice, quinoa, or wheat in many recipes. Cooking methods include:

  • Boiling or steaming for porridges and pilafs

  • Popping like popcorn for crunchy snacks

  • Baking with millet flour for breads, muffins, pancakes, and cookies

Try experimenting with savory millet dishes, salads, and sweet treats to enjoy the flavor, texture, and nutrition of these versatile grains.


Environmental Benefits of Millets

Millets are not only healthy but also environmentally friendly.

  • Require less water than rice or wheat

  • Resistant to pests and diseases

  • Promote sustainable farming practices

  • Help in conserving water resources and reducing agricultural carbon footprint

Choosing millets is a way to support both personal health and planet-friendly agriculture.
